
python聊天智能回复话题讨论。解读python聊天智能回复知识,想了解学习python聊天智能回复,请参与python聊天智能回复话题讨论。
python聊天智能回复话题已于 2025-10-30 13:44:58 更新
一、使用Python编写自动回复脚本 这是一种技术实现方式,通过安装pyautogui、pyperclip和cnocr等Python库,可以模拟鼠标和键盘操作,访问剪切板进行复制粘贴,以及进行中文OCR识别。这种方法适用于需要在特定软件或平台上进行自动回复的场景,如微信、QQ等聊天工具。通过监听聊天消息,截取聊天区域并提取关键字,...
具体方法如下:创建微信AI聊天机器人:工具选择:使用Python编程语言,结合wxauto库实现微信消息的自动发送和接收,同时利用langchain库调用AI大模型来生成回复内容。实现原理:通过wxauto库监听微信消息,当收到新消息时,利用langchain库中的AI大模型分析消息内容并生成合适的回复,再通过wxauto库发送回复消息...
用户输入解析:利用自然语言处理库,对用户输入进行解析,提取出关键信息和意图。AI模型调用:根据解析出的信息和意图,调用预训练的AI模型进行推理和生成回复。对话结果生成:将AI模型的输出转换为自然语言形式的回复,并呈现给用户。添加其他功能:根据需求,可以为智能体添加其他功能,如读取本地文档、总结...
编写Python脚本,调用百度语音识别的API,将录音文件转换为文本。智能回复:在图灵机器人官网申请账号,获取API_KEY。在Python脚本中调用图灵机器人的API,将语音识别结果发送给图灵机器人,并接收其返回的回复文本。语音合成:在百度AI平台申请语音合成的API服务,获取client_id和client_secret。使用百度语音合...
ItChat确实可以重新用于搭建微信聊天机器人。以下是关于如何搭建属于你的微信聊天机器人的关键信息:ItChat简介:ItChat是一个开源的Python库,它提供了简洁的API和强大的功能,如登录微信、消息发送与接收、群组管理等。ItChat是开发者们与微信世界沟通的桥梁,支持自动化回复、数据采集等多种项目。ItChat的...
ChatterBot:这是一款基于Python编程语言的智能对话引擎,可用于构建基于规则和机器学习的对话系统。其简单易用的特点使得用户能够快速搭建智能对话应用,满足基本的交互需求。aimate人工智能助理与智谱清言AI对话软件:这两款软件均集成了先进的人工智能技术,通过深度学习和自然语言处理技术,能够理解并响应用户...
安装:可以通过pip命令进行安装。spaCy 简介:主要是一个自然语言处理库,提供了丰富的文本处理功能。特点:功能包括分词、词性标注、命名实体识别等,对构建聊天机器人非常有用。设计注重效率,适合处理大量文本数据。Natural Language Toolkit (NLTK)简介:Python中最早的自然语言处理库之一。特点:提供了广泛...
将返回的json字符串转化为python对象,以便进行解析和处理。错误处理与调试:如遇到未认证状态导致的40003错误,检查请求次数是否超出限制。使用在线工具观察和分析json结构,以解决异常返回问题。通过以上步骤,YSpython程序即可成功接入图灵聊天机器人,实现与用户的智能对话。
对于有一定编程基础的用户,可以通过安装itchat、wxpy等Python库,写代码来监控微信消息并自动回复。例如,当有人发送“讲笑话”时,可以调用API回复一个段子。这种方式需要自己搭建服务器。使用现成的机器人服务:可以选择如二狗机器人等现成的机器人服务。这些服务提供了丰富的机器人功能,如成语接龙、猜歌...
3. 编写机器人脚本:在机器人账号中,可以编写机器人脚本,例如自动回复、自动邀请等。可以使用 Python、Java 等编程语言,或者使用现成的机器人框架,例如 BotStar、Botpress 等。4. 将机器人加入聊天室:在聊天室中,可以将机器人账号加入聊天室,并设置机器人的权限和职责。例如,可以设置机器人自动...